F.S. 633.506
633.506 Legislative intent.It is the intent of the Legislature to enhance firefighter occupational safety and health in the state through the implementation and maintenance of policies, procedures, practices, rules, and standards that reduce the incidence of firefighter employee accidents, firefighter employee occupational diseases, and firefighter employee fatalities compensable under chapter 440 or otherwise. The Legislature further intends that the division develop a means by which the division can identify individual firefighter employers with a high frequency or severity of work-related injuries, conduct safety inspections of those firefighter employers, and assist those firefighter employers in the development and implementation of firefighter employee safety and health programs. In addition, it is the intent of the Legislature that the division administer and enforce this part; provide assistance to firefighter employers, firefighter employees, and insurers; and enforce the policies, rules, and standards set forth in this part.
History.s. 15, ch. 2002-404; s. 78, ch. 2013-183.
Note.Former s. 633.803.
